A few years ago, we revived a New Year's Day party that we had long done and then suspended. It's interesting what people bring as host gifts. People don't tend to bring wine; the attitude seems to be coals to Newcastle. One man, whom I have known for many years but more as a cultural acquaintance than a friend, is a passionate cook. He and his wife brought little jars of his homemade relishes and sauces. The first year, another couple brought an art deco Lucite wine coaster; the next year, a bottle of their favorite salad dressing and a set of carved wooden salad tossers. The chef/owner that I work with on her wine list brought a whole Romesco broccoli. People get very creative. We keep little boxes of dark chocolate-covered candied orange rind from Lilac to take to hosts of parties or dinners. This was a good read, Thanks.
